use the venn diagram to calculate probabilities. which probabilities are correct? select two options.
p(a|c) = 2/3
p(c|b) = 8/27
p(a) = 31/59
p(c) = 3/7
p(b|a) = 13/27
Step1: Calculate the total number of elements
Total \(n(U)=12 + 5+11 + 6+8 + 3+4+10=59\)
Step2: Calculate \(P(A)\)
\(n(A)=12 + 5+6+8=31\), so \(P(A)=\frac{n(A)}{n(U)}=\frac{31}{59}\)
Step3: Calculate \(P(C)\)
\(n(C)=6 + 8+3+4 = 21\), so \(P(C)=\frac{n(C)}{n(U)}=\frac{21}{59}
eq\frac{3}{7}\)
Step4: Calculate \(P(A|C)\)
\(n(A\cap C)=6 + 8=14\), \(n(C) = 21\). By the formula \(P(A|C)=\frac{n(A\cap C)}{n(C)}=\frac{14}{21}=\frac{2}{3}\)
Step5: Calculate \(P(C|B)\)
\(n(B\cap C)=8 + 3=11\), \(n(B)=5 + 11+8 + 3=27\). By the formula \(P(C|B)=\frac{n(B\cap C)}{n(B)}=\frac{11}{27}
eq\frac{8}{27}\)
Step6: Calculate \(P(B|A)\)
\(n(A\cap B)=5 + 8=13\), \(n(A)=31\). By the formula \(P(B|A)=\frac{n(A\cap B)}{n(A)}=\frac{13}{31}
eq\frac{13}{27}\)
